The Clinton Foundation HIV AIDS Initiative (CHAI) is seeking motivated physicians, nurse practitioners, nurse midwives and nurses with at least 3 years of clinical experience in HIV/AIDS treatment.  Experience working in a developing country is helpful. We are looking for clinicians who have expertise in both didactic and practical teaching, as well as those with the management skills necessary to help a clinic become more efficient and effective.

 Full-time positions are available in several countries in Africa and Asia

 Responsibilities:

§  Provide didactic and practical instruction on antiretroviral use and the identification of HIV exposed and infected children and adults

§  Provide analysis to CHAI country team of possible interventions to improve care systems

§  Increase the appropriate use of PMTCT as well as solidify PMTCT protocol

§  Establish and maintain connections between the HIV clinic and other clinics (eg., TB, in-patient wards, maternal-child health) where HIV infected patients can be identified

§  Provide technical expertise on organization of work and task shifting

§  Implement monitoring & evaluation tools to assess clinic progress
